ingredients
- 1 (10 ounce) package spinach (frozen chopped spinach, thawed & drained well)
- 1 lb Velveeta cheese,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
- 4 ounces cream cheese, cut up (1/2 of 8 oz. brick package Philadelphia)
- 1 (10 ounce) can ro*tel diced tomatoes and green chilies, undrained
- 8 slices bacon, crisply cooked, drained and crumbled
directions
- COMBINE ingredients in microwaveable bowl.
- MICROWAVE on HIGH 5 minute or until VELVEETA is completely melted and mixture is well blended, stirring after 3 minute.

Very tasty - I love finding ways to get spinach into my family's diets, and dip is an easy way to do it, because the other flavors balance the spinach very well. The only difference I made when making this was to mix it into the crock part of a small crock pot, and let it sit in the refrigerator overnight to let the flavors come together, then about an hour and half before serving time, put the crock into the base and turned it on, so the dip would stay hot. I personally prefer regular bacon, rather than the pre-cooked, but that's a matter of personal preference.
